About This Item

Elkton, Maryland: Myst & Lace Publishers, Inc., 2001. Soft cover. Near Fine. Signed by the author on the tile page as follows: "Ed O"; not personalized to anyone. Someone has blackened out the price on the back cover of the work, otherwise the book would grade fine. No apparent underlining, no highlighting, no bookplates, no owner names, not ex-libris, no remainder marks, no folded or dogeared pages. A very nice, author signed, copy.
